Location : Mohali City : Mohali State : Punjab (IN-PB) Country : India (IN) Requisition Number : 41233 Job Description Business Title Manager - Sales Operations Global Jo…
Location : Mohali City : Mohali State : Punjab (IN-PB) Country : India (IN) Requisition Number : 40771 Role Purpose Statement Business Analyst Sustainability will be re…
Location : Mohali City : Mohali State : Punjab (IN-PB) Country : India (IN) Requisition Number : 39430 Job Description Business Title Manager - Sales Operations Global Jo…
Location : Mohali City : Mohali State : Punjab (IN-PB) Country : India (IN) Requisition Number : 39429 Job Description Business Title Manager- OTC Global Job Title Mgr I …